Property
| Property | Mistral | Palisade |
|---|---|---|
| Alpha acid | 6.5–8.5% | 5.5–10% |
| Beta acid | 3.1–3.8% | 5.5–8% |
| Co-humulone | 29–39% | 24–29% |
| Total oil | 1–1.5 mL | 0.8–2 mL |
| Myrcene | 59–65% | 45–55% |
| Humulene | 9–13% | 10–20% |
| Caryophyllene | 3–4% | 8–16% |
| Farnesene | 2–4% | 0–1% |
| Origin | France | United States |
| Purpose | Dual purpose | Dual purpose |
